Ohio State University Plant Dictionary

Scientific Name:
Cortaderia selloana

Family:
Pampas Grass

Family:
Poaceae (also known as Gramineae)

Description:
Pampas Grass is a specimen ornamental grass that is effective en masse or as a strong focal point. It is extensively utilized in zone 8 and warmer climates, but struggles with its Winter hardiness in zone 7, and must be treated as a container grass or annual grass in cooler climates.
